The business trip of the representatives of Kimyo International University in Tashkent to South Korea continues


The business trip of the representatives of Kimyo International University in Tashkent to South Korea continues. Today, there was a meeting with the rector of Hankyong National University Lee Wonhee. Vice-President of Hyundai Rotem company, Jong-Chil Chae also took part in the meeting and stressed that he had come specifically to meet with the delegation and was glad that the cooperation between universities were developing. Also, the rector of the partner university introduced the activities of the innovation centers of the educational institution and the conditions created for students. After discussing issues of mutual cooperation and sharing best practices, an open dialogue was held with students of Kimyo International University in Tashkent studying under the 2+2 and 1+3 programs.
